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Most Commercial Law matters handled by practitioners in Southbank, VIC can be resolved through negotiation, mediation, or alternative dispute resolution without requiring court appearances. However, if a dispute escalates significantly or other resolution methods prove unsuccessful, proceeding to court or tribunal may become necessary to protect your interests.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Commercial Law lawyers cost in Southbank, VIC?
Commercial lawyers in Southbank, VIC typically charge between $350 and $750 per hour. Hourly rates fluctuate based on the practitioner's expertise, firm size, and specific location within the area, though your total legal costs ultimately depend on how much time your matter requires. Straightforward matters like contract reviews or basic commercial advice generally fall at the lower end of this range and require fewer billable hours. Mid-complexity issues such as drafting partnership agreements or handling routine commercial disputes sit in the middle range, while sophisticated matters involving mergers and acquisitions, complex litigation, or extensive due diligence processes demand significantly more preparation time and attract the higher rates.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Commercial Law lawyer in Southbank, VIC?
Preparing for your first meeting with a Commercial Law lawyer in Southbank, VIC becomes smoother when you gather relevant paperwork beforehand. It can help to have photo identification, your business registration documents, and any existing commercial contracts or agreements available. If available, these documents can be useful: financial statements, correspondence with other parties, invoices or payment records, and any legal notices you've received. You may be asked to provide partnership agreements, company constitutions, or lease documents depending on your specific commercial matter.
